set snmp usm
189
access {read-only | read-notify | notify-only | read-write
| notify-read-write}
— Specifies the access level of the user:
read-only
—An SNMP management application using the string
can get (read) object values on the switch but cannot set (write)
them.
read-notify
—An SNMP management application using the string
can get object values on the switch but cannot set them. The
switch can use the string to send notifications.
notify-only
—The switch can use the string to send notifications.
read-write
—An SNMP management application using the string
can get and set object values on the switch.
notify-read-write
— An SNMP management application using
the string can get and set object values on the switch. The switch
can use the string to send notifications.
auth-type {none | md5 | sha} {auth-pass-phrase string |
auth-key hex-string}
— Specifies the authentication type used to
authenticate communications with the remote SNMP engine. You can
specify one of the following:
none
—No authentication is used.
md5
—Message-digest algorithm 5 is used.
sha
—Secure Hashing Algorithm (SHA) is used.
If the authentication type is md5 or sha, you can specify a passphrase
or a hexadecimal key.
To specify a passphrase, use the auth-pass-phrase string option.
The string can be from 8 to 32 alphanumeric characters long, with
no spaces.
To specify a key, use the auth-key hex-string option.
encrypt-type {none | des | 3des | aes}
{encrypt-pass-phrase string | encrypt-key hex-string}
—
Specifies the encryption type used for SNMP traffic. You can specify
one of the following:
none
—No encryption is used. This is the default.
des
—Data Encryption Standard (DES) encryption is used.
3des
—Triple DES encryption is used.
aes
—Advanced Encryption Standard (AES) encryption is used.
